Columbia State Community College is a two-year college serving a nine-county area in southern Middle Tennessee with four campuses, including Columbia, Williamson, Lawrence and Lewisburg. Columbia State was established in 1966 as Tennessee's first community college. For more information, visit www.ColumbiaState.edu.

Columbia State Student's Short Story Featured in National Sigma Kappa Delta Journal

Olivia Ferrara, a Columbia State Community College student, recently had her short story featured in the Sigma Kappa Delta Honor Society journal, Hedera helix. The journal, with submissions from community college students from across the country, features short stories, photography, poetry, essays and more. Ferrara, a Columbia native, received first place in the Short Fiction category with her piece, "Ears to Hear, and Eyes to See." She also received a $500 award for her work.

Columbia State Students Inducted Into Sigma Kappa Delta Honor Society

Columbia State students were inducted into Sigma Kappa Delta, the national English honor society for two-year colleges. The honor society promotes honors excellence in English, and members enjoy writing, reading, discussion and fellowship. Membership is open to students who have completed one college English course and who maintain a 3.0 GPA or higher in English and other scholarship.

Columbia State Announces Largest Induction into Honor Society in History

The Beta Theta Kappa Chapter of Phi Theta Kappa has completed its single largest induction of students into the honor society in its history. 100 new students have brought the total number of Honor Society students to more than 300. "This year is record setting for Columbia State," said President Smith. "The 100 new members of Phi Theta Kappa is the single largest class of honor society inductees in our history."
